| /llvm-project-15.0.7/lldb/source/Symbol/ |
| H A D | SymbolFile.cpp | 204 CompUnitSP SymbolFileCommon::GetCompileUnitAtIndex(uint32_t idx) { in GetCompileUnitAtIndex() 209 lldb::CompUnitSP &cu_sp = (*m_compile_units)[idx]; in GetCompileUnitAtIndex() 216 const CompUnitSP &cu_sp) { in SetCompileUnitAtIndex() 262 for (const CompUnitSP &cu_sp : *m_compile_units) { in Dump()
|
| H A D | SymbolFileOnDemand.cpp | 577 CompUnitSP SymbolFileOnDemand::GetCompileUnitAtIndex(uint32_t idx) { in GetCompileUnitAtIndex()
|
| /llvm-project-15.0.7/lldb/include/lldb/Symbol/ |
| H A D | SymbolFile.h | 140 virtual lldb::CompUnitSP GetCompileUnitAtIndex(uint32_t idx) = 0; 416 lldb::CompUnitSP GetCompileUnitAtIndex(uint32_t idx) override; 440 virtual lldb::CompUnitSP ParseCompileUnitAtIndex(uint32_t idx) = 0; 442 void SetCompileUnitAtIndex(uint32_t idx, const lldb::CompUnitSP &cu_sp); 448 llvm::Optional<std::vector<lldb::CompUnitSP>> m_compile_units;
|
| H A D | SymbolFileOnDemand.h | 56 lldb::CompUnitSP GetCompileUnitAtIndex(uint32_t idx) override;
|
| /llvm-project-15.0.7/lldb/source/Plugins/SymbolFile/PDB/ |
| H A D | SymbolFilePDB.h | 182 lldb::CompUnitSP ParseCompileUnitAtIndex(uint32_t index) override; 184 lldb::CompUnitSP ParseCompileUnitForUID(uint32_t id, 208 lldb::CompUnitSP 246 llvm::DenseMap<uint32_t, lldb::CompUnitSP> m_comp_units;
|
| H A D | SymbolFilePDB.cpp | 255 lldb::CompUnitSP SymbolFilePDB::ParseCompileUnitAtIndex(uint32_t index) { in ParseCompileUnitAtIndex() 257 return CompUnitSP(); in ParseCompileUnitAtIndex() 264 return CompUnitSP(); in ParseCompileUnitAtIndex() 267 return CompUnitSP(); in ParseCompileUnitAtIndex() 1723 lldb::CompUnitSP SymbolFilePDB::ParseCompileUnitForUID(uint32_t id, in ParseCompileUnitForUID() 1731 return CompUnitSP(); in ParseCompileUnitForUID() 1741 return CompUnitSP(); in ParseCompileUnitForUID() 1745 return CompUnitSP(); in ParseCompileUnitForUID() 1754 return CompUnitSP(); in ParseCompileUnitForUID() 1887 lldb::CompUnitSP SymbolFilePDB::GetCompileUnitContainsAddress( in GetCompileUnitContainsAddress()
|
| /llvm-project-15.0.7/lldb/source/Plugins/SymbolFile/DWARF/ |
| H A D | SymbolFileDWARFDebugMap.h | 173 lldb::CompUnitSP compile_unit_sp; 193 lldb::CompUnitSP ParseCompileUnitAtIndex(uint32_t index) override; 260 const lldb::CompUnitSP &cu_sp); 262 lldb::CompUnitSP GetCompileUnit(SymbolFileDWARF *oso_dwarf);
|
| H A D | SymbolFileDWARFDebugMap.cpp | 562 CompUnitSP SymbolFileDWARFDebugMap::ParseCompileUnitAtIndex(uint32_t cu_idx) { in ParseCompileUnitAtIndex() 563 CompUnitSP comp_unit_sp; in ParseCompileUnitAtIndex() 1219 lldb::CompUnitSP 1254 const CompUnitSP &cu_sp) { in SetCompileUnit()
|
| H A D | SymbolFileDWARF.h | 353 lldb::CompUnitSP ParseCompileUnitAtIndex(uint32_t index) override; 357 lldb::CompUnitSP ParseCompileUnit(DWARFCompileUnit &dwarf_cu);
|
| H A D | SymbolFileDWARF.cpp | 698 lldb::CompUnitSP SymbolFileDWARF::ParseCompileUnit(DWARFCompileUnit &dwarf_cu) { in ParseCompileUnit() 699 CompUnitSP cu_sp; in ParseCompileUnit() 811 CompUnitSP SymbolFileDWARF::ParseCompileUnitAtIndex(uint32_t cu_idx) { in ParseCompileUnitAtIndex() 1881 CompUnitSP cu_sp = module_sp->GetCompileUnitAtIndex(i); in GetGlobalAranges()
|
| /llvm-project-15.0.7/lldb/source/Plugins/SymbolFile/NativePDB/ |
| H A D | SymbolFileNativePDB.h | 186 lldb::CompUnitSP ParseCompileUnitAtIndex(uint32_t index) override; 222 lldb::CompUnitSP GetOrCreateCompileUnit(const CompilandIndexItem &cci); 238 lldb::CompUnitSP CreateCompileUnit(const CompilandIndexItem &cci); 272 llvm::DenseMap<lldb::user_id_t, lldb::CompUnitSP> m_compilands;
|
| H A D | SymbolFileNativePDB.cpp | 338 CompUnitSP comp_unit = GetOrCreateCompileUnit(*cii); in CreateBlock() 441 CompUnitSP 456 CompUnitSP cu_sp = in CreateCompileUnit() 809 CompUnitSP comp_unit; in CreateGlobalVariable() 902 CompUnitSP 930 lldb::CompUnitSP SymbolFileNativePDB::ParseCompileUnitAtIndex(uint32_t index) { in ParseCompileUnitAtIndex() 932 return CompUnitSP(); in ParseCompileUnitAtIndex() 1001 CompUnitSP cu_sp = GetCompileUnitAtIndex(*modi); in ResolveSymbolContext() 1302 CompUnitSP comp_unit = GetOrCreateCompileUnit(*cii); in ParseInlineSite() 1709 CompUnitSP comp_unit_sp = GetOrCreateCompileUnit(*cii); in CreateLocalVariable()
|
| /llvm-project-15.0.7/lldb/source/Plugins/SymbolFile/Symtab/ |
| H A D | SymbolFileSymtab.cpp | 113 CompUnitSP SymbolFileSymtab::ParseCompileUnitAtIndex(uint32_t idx) { in ParseCompileUnitAtIndex() 114 CompUnitSP cu_sp; in ParseCompileUnitAtIndex()
|
| H A D | SymbolFileSymtab.h | 93 lldb::CompUnitSP ParseCompileUnitAtIndex(uint32_t index) override;
|
| /llvm-project-15.0.7/lldb/unittests/SymbolFile/DWARF/ |
| H A D | XcodeSDKModuleTests.cpp | 67 CompUnitSP comp_unit = sym_file.GetCompileUnitAtIndex(0); in TEST_F()
|
| /llvm-project-15.0.7/lldb/tools/lldb-test/ |
| H A D | lldb-test.cpp | 428 lldb::CompUnitSP cu_sp = Module.GetCompileUnitAtIndex(i); in findFunctions() 482 lldb::CompUnitSP cu_sp = Module.GetCompileUnitAtIndex(i); in findBlocks() 567 CompUnitSP CU; in findVariables() 569 CompUnitSP Candidate = Module.GetCompileUnitAtIndex(Ind); in findVariables() 669 lldb::CompUnitSP comp_unit = symfile->GetCompileUnitAtIndex(i); in verify()
|
| /llvm-project-15.0.7/lldb/source/Breakpoint/ |
| H A D | BreakpointResolverFileLine.cpp | 247 CompUnitSP cu_sp(context.module_sp->GetCompileUnitAtIndex(i)); in SearchCallback()
|
| /llvm-project-15.0.7/lldb/source/Plugins/SymbolFile/Breakpad/ |
| H A D | SymbolFileBreakpad.h | 211 lldb::CompUnitSP ParseCompileUnitAtIndex(uint32_t index) override;
|
| H A D | SymbolFileBreakpad.cpp | 192 CompUnitSP SymbolFileBreakpad::ParseCompileUnitAtIndex(uint32_t index) { in ParseCompileUnitAtIndex() 431 CompUnitSP cu_sp = GetCompileUnitAtIndex(i); in FindFunctions()
|
| /llvm-project-15.0.7/lldb/source/Core/ |
| H A D | SearchFilter.cpp | 302 CompUnitSP cu_sp(module_sp->GetCompileUnitAtIndex(i)); in DoCUIteration() 758 CompUnitSP cu_sp = module_sp->GetCompileUnitAtIndex(cu_idx); in Search()
|
| H A D | Module.cpp | 423 CompUnitSP Module::GetCompileUnitAtIndex(size_t index) { in GetCompileUnitAtIndex() 426 CompUnitSP cu_sp; in GetCompileUnitAtIndex()
|
| /llvm-project-15.0.7/lldb/include/lldb/Core/ |
| H A D | Module.h | 554 lldb::CompUnitSP GetCompileUnitAtIndex(size_t idx);
|
| /llvm-project-15.0.7/lldb/source/API/ |
| H A D | SBModule.cpp | 269 CompUnitSP cu_sp = module_sp->GetCompileUnitAtIndex(index); in GetCompileUnitAtIndex()
|
| /llvm-project-15.0.7/lldb/include/lldb/ |
| H A D | lldb-forward.h | 312 typedef std::shared_ptr<lldb_private::CompileUnit> CompUnitSP; typedef
|
| /llvm-project-15.0.7/lldb/source/Commands/ |
| H A D | CommandObjectSource.cpp | 285 CompUnitSP cu_sp(module->GetCompileUnitAtIndex(i)); in DumpFileLinesInModule()
|